    The Heart of an Ice Machine: Understanding the Fans Role

    As the heart of an ice machine, the fan plays a crucial role in the ice-making process. Its primary function is to circulate cold air evenly throughout the freezer compartment, ensuring that the water freezes evenly and efficiently. Without proper air circulation, ice would form unevenly, resulting in inconsistent cube sizes and diminished cooling capacity.

    Troubleshooting Common Ice Machine Fan Issues

    If you notice a decline in ice production or uneven freezing, it may indicate fan-related issues. Common problems include: - Frozen Fan Blades: Ice buildup on the fan blades can impede airflow. Defrost the ice machine and manually remove ice from the blades. - Loose or Damaged Blades: Ensure the fan blades are securely attached and not damaged. Replace damaged blades as needed. - Motor Failure: In rare cases, the fan motor may fail. If the fan does not operate when the ice machine is turned on, consider replacing the motor.

    Maintenance Tips for Optimal Fan Performance

    To ensure optimal fan performance and longevity, follow these maintenance tips: - Clean the Fan Regularly: Use a soft brush or cloth to remove dust and debris from the fan blades and housing. - Lubricate the Motor: Periodically lubricate the fan motor to reduce friction and extend its lifespan.
